About Motorway

Motorway is the UK's largest online car-selling platform. We connect private sellers directly with over 8,000 dealers nationwide. Our online platform helps sellers achieve great prices for their cars while giving dealers fast, reliable access to the stock they want for their dealerships. Founded in 2017, our award-winning, technology-led approach has redefined the experience of selling a car. Motorway is backed by some of the world’s leading technology investors, having raised £143 million in Series C funding.

The Dealer Resolutions role is on the front line when dealing with high-risk complaints from dealers that require cross-department collaboration. You will be right there resolving complex dealer issues, providing exceptional support, and helping us improve what we do by collaborating across different departments to prevent potential reputational risk. A Dealer Resolutions Specialist will own complex cases from start to finish, handle formal complaints, and provide dedicated support to the dealer throughout the cases' journey, including managing business-critical issues escalated to the C-suite.

What you’ll be doing:

  • High-Stakes Escalation Management: Own and resolve the most complex, sensitive, and high-emotion dealer escalations from intake to final resolution, serving as the definitive point of contact for aggrieved parties.

  • Reputation Risk Mitigation: Proactively identify, assess, and manage potential brand and legal risks embedded in complaints, neutralizing negative exposure across social media, review platforms, and regulatory bodies.

  • Incident Response Coordination: Lead the immediate response to critical service incidents or systemic failures, orchestrating cross-functional communication to ensure impacted customers are managed with transparency, speed, and care.

  • Strategic Goodwill Administration: Exercise autonomous judgment in awarding Gestures of Goodwill (GoGs), financial compensation, or fee waivers, balancing customer retention with commercial viability and internal policy frameworks.

  • Root-Cause Analysis & Continuous Improvement: Transform negative feedback into operational intelligence by analyzing complaint data and trend patterns, partnering with leadership to implement process changes that eliminate future friction points.

  • Compliance & Audit Readiness: Ensure all final responses and case documentation strictly adhere to regulatory guidelines, industry compliance standards, and tight internal Service Level Agreements (SLAs).
